  Tensile strength - Wikipedia, the free encyclopedia
The tensile strength of a material is the maximum amount of tensile stress that it can be subjected to before it breaks.
Tensile strength is measured in units of force per unit area.
In brittle materials such as rock, concrete, cast iron, or soil, tensile strength is negligible compared to the compressive strength and it is assumed zero for most engineering applications.

 Tensile stress - Wikipedia, the free encyclopedia
Tensile stress (or tension) is the stress state leading to expansion; that is, the length of a material tends to increase in the tensile direction.
In the uniaxial manner of tension, tensile stress is induced by pulling forces across a bar, specimen, etc. Tensile stress is the opposite of compressive stress.
Tensile stress may be increased until the reach of tensile strength, namely the limit state of stress.

 Tensile Property Testing of Plastics   (Site not responding. Last check: 2007-10-08)
The ability of a material to resist breaking under tensile stress is one of the most important and widely measured properties of materials used in structural applications.
The tensile testing machine pulls the sample from both ends and measures the force required to pull the specimen apart and how much the sample stretches before breaking.
The tensile modulus is the ratio of stress to elastic strain in tension.

 Tensile Test Plastics ASTM D 638 D 882 D 1708 ISO 527
Tensile tests measure the force required to break a specimen and the extent to which the specimen stretches or elongates to that breaking point.
Tensile tests produce a stress-strain diagram, which is used to determine tensile modulus.
An extensometer is used to determine elongation and tensile modulus.

 Working with high tensile wire   (Site not responding. Last check: 2007-10-08)
High tensile fences are stronger and usually less expensive to build than traditional barbed and woven wire fences.
High tensile wire can be "tied off" to brace posts using knots, nicopress sleeves or wire vises.
High tensile wire may be stiff, but you'll find it relatively easy to make a simple half hitch knot to fasten the wire to brace posts (figures 2 and 3).
